Ad Agency Uses Malala Yousafzai Shooting to Sell Mattresses
In a new low in ghoulish marketing, an ad agency in India has used the shooting of Malala Yousafzai to sell mattresses.
Since the theme of the print campaign for Kurl-On mattresses is “bounce back,” a cartoon image of the young Pakistani activist being shot in the face by the Taliban and recovering to win a humanitarian award makes sense, right?
Don’t worry, no one else gets it either.
Ogilvy & Mather India, the agency responsible, has launched an internal investigation and apologized, saying, “We deeply regret this incident…and will take whatever corrective action is necessary.” Read more...
